A humanitarian initiative dedicated to providing nutritious meals to orphans during the holy month of Ramadan. This project seeks to alleviate hunger, spread joy, and foster a sense of belonging to 2,000 privileged vulnerable people and children, ensuring they experience the blessings and communal spirit of Ramadan.
Orphans in underserved communities face food insecurity, social isolation, and neglect, especially during Ramadan. Many lack access to regular, nutritious meals, making it hard to observe fasting or participate in communal celebrations. Limited resources in orphanages further exacerbate their struggles. This project seeks to address these issues by providing meals, fostering inclusion, and raising awareness to ensure orphans experience the blessings of Ramadan.
The project will solve the problem by providing daily Iftar and Suhoor meals to orphans, ensuring they have access to nutritious food throughout Ramadan. It will collaborate with orphanages, foster homes, and local organizations to identify beneficiaries and establish meal distribution centers. Additionally, community Iftar events will foster inclusion and a sense of belonging, while volunteer and donor engagement will raise awareness about orphan care and inspire long-term support.
The project's long-term impact includes improved well-being and nutrition for orphans, fostering their physical and emotional development. By creating a sense of inclusion and belonging, it can boost their self-esteem and community integration. The initiative also raises public awareness about the challenges faced by orphans, encouraging sustained support and advocacy.
